I am going to add a ez-wiring 21 kit to my truck... I have new circuits that my '78 never had like electric fuel pump, electric choke, etc... I am also going to migrate into the factory harness plugs...
I unfortunately bought the Black kit with all black wires so that may make it tougher....
now.....
I am just trying to get the rear lights done... those wires are in great shape so no need for me to replace those wires in that harness....
4 wires in that oem harness.....
Current wires | what I believe they are
Light Green | Reverse Lights
Dark Green | Right Turn Signal
Yellow | Left Turn Signal
Brown | Parking Light
EZ Wiring 21 rear wire section: they bundle up the wires into sections and the following were in that section:
Wire Name | Number | Use (Y/N)
Third Brake Light. | 19 | No
Dome Light | 43 | No
Trunk Light | 42 | No
Electric Fuel Pump | 41 | Yes
Fuel Gauge | 40 | Yes
Right Rear Turn | 21 | Yes
Left Rear Turn | 20 | Yes
Left Tail Park | 35 | Yes
Right Tail Park | 36 | Yes
I was able to connect the left and right turn signal...
the other 2 wires in the kit were loose....
so my first question..
Where do they go?
light green and brown????
